Compare Antioch to West Hollywood

This post compares Antioch, California to West Hollywood,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Antioch (city) West Hollywood (city)
Population 110,026 36,148
Income (median) $49,835 $63,795
Home Value (median) $330,900 $684,200
White 44% 79%
Black 20% 4%
Asian 10% 5%
With Kids 43% 3%
Age (median) 35 39
Rentals 39% 78%

Questions and Answers:

Q: Which is more populated, Antioch or West Hollywood?
A: Antioch has a larger population count than West Hollywood: 110026 compared with 36148 total people.

Q: Do incomes tend to be higher in Antioch or in West Hollywood?
A: Incomes are on average lower in Antioch.

Q: Are homes more expensive in Antioch or West Hollywood?
A: Homes tend to be much less expensive in Antioch.

Q: Which has a higher percentage of housing rental units?
A: West Hollywood does. The percentage of rentals differs quite a bit: 39% for Antioch versus 78% for West Hollywood.
